    Asante Africa Foundation was established in 2006 by Erna Grasz, a corporate executive, Emmy Moshi, a Tanzanian entrepreneur, and school principal and a member of the Kenyan Maasai tribe. The foundation began as a small two-village project, and has since expanded across Kenya , Uganda and Tanzania .

    TrustAfrica, originally called the "Special Initiative for Africa", [1] is an independent foundation that works to secure the conditions for democracy and equitable development throughout the continent. Led by Africans, it convenes dialogues, catalyzes ideas, and provides grants and technical assistance to organizations working to advance these ...

    The Future Africa Leaders Award was established in 2013 and is organized every year by the Future Africa Leaders Foundation, a sub-organization of the Chris Oyakhilome Foundation International (COFI). The Award recognizes the role of young leaders as drivers of progress and development in Africa, and therefore only youths in Africa between the ...
